Pauline “Paula” “Lala” Munos Sandoval, 86, East Moline, surrounded by her loving, devoted husband and
family, passed from this world into the arms of her Heavenly Father as He said, “Well done good and faithful
servant”.
Visitation will be held at 4-7 pm on Wednesday, August 19, 2020, at Esterdahl Mortuary and Crematory, Ltd.,
Moline. Private Mass of Christian Burial will be held at Our Lady of Guadalupe Parish, Silvis. The service
will be livestreamed and can be viewed Thursday, August 20, 2020, at 10:00 am found at esterdahl.com.
Burial will be at the Rock Island National Cemetery. Memorials may be left to the family.
From the time she was a teen, Paula loved dancing to Mexican music and playing the maracas. She loved life
and people, beauty, and fashion. All made her a successful hair stylist for 32 years. She was fun-loving with a
contagious laugh, a fabulous cook, a fancy little lady with fashionable scarves and sunglasses, a gift giver with
meticulously wrapped presents and handmade bows. Her first grandson Jason gave her the name “Lala”, it was
adopted by many and has carried through the generations; she was the blessed matriarch of five generations.
She lived for her family and she loved spending time with them.
She has left a legacy of love and faith. She effortlessly loved everyone with the love of Jesus, gracefully,
unconditionally and without judgement. Her unwavering faith in Jesus Christ miraculously cured her of cancer
three times; she chose prayer over chemo.
Those left to continue her legacy are her husband Edmund “Pep” Sandoval, children Dave Munos, Pam (Mike)
Savala, Tiffany (Tim) Spurgetis, Tori Petri, Jon Sandoval, 12 grandchildren, 15 great grandchildren and 4 great
great grandsons, sister Julia (Ray) Cervantez and an abundance of nieces and nephews.
She was preceded in death by her parents Tomasa and Eulalio Galvan, sisters, Rafaela Gomez, Patricia Garza,
Lucy Garcia, Mary Terronez, brother George Sierra and son Michael Munos.
